US Number of Adult Arrests By Race and Ethnicity for Stolen Property Buying Receiving Possessing Offenses in 2023

Updated on June 27, 2025.

According to the FBI UCR data, in 2023, there were 59,908 adult arrests made in the US for stolen property buying receiving possessing offenses.

By Race: The highest number of those arrested were identified as White (35.76K), followed by Black or African American (22.00K), and Asian (980).

By Ethnicity: Ethnicity information was reported for 52,301 (87%) of those arrested. Among those for whom ethnicity was reported, the highest number were identified as Not Hispanic or Latino (40.55K), followed by Hispanic or Latino (11.75K).

US Number of Adult Arrests By Race for Stolen Property Buying Receiving Possessing Offenses in 2023

Race Number of Arrests Percent of Total (%)
White 35755 59.7
Black or African American 21998 36.7
Asian 980 1.6
American Indian or Alaska Native 803 1.3
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ander 372 0.6
US Number of Adult Arrests By Ethnicity for Stolen Property Buying Receiving Possessing Offenses in 2023

Ethnicity Number of Arrests Percent of Total (%)
Not Hispanic or Latino 40547 77.5
Hispanic or Latino 11754 22.5
